Global Trade Technical Product Owner (TPO)

As a Global Trade Technical Product Owner, you will lead technology product ownership and roadmap development for Global Trade products aligned with business objectives. You'll collaborate with Domain Leads, Solution Leads, Architects, and Data teams to design, build, and sustain capabilities. Our team is customer-focused, ensuring every decision starts and ends with the customer.

Work Model: Hybrid role requiring 3–4 days onsite in New Brunswick, NJ or a Cognizant office. Flexibility and work-life balance are supported through wellbeing programs. Schedule may vary based on project needs.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Define product vision and roadmap; prioritize backlog and translate requirements into user stories.
  • Balance business value with technical feasibility; optimize cost and delivery efficiency.
  • Act as "voice of the customer" and ensure compliance with security, privacy, and regulatory standards.
  • Manage team resourcing, onboarding, and coaching; lead ceremonies and release planning.
  • Collaborate across squads, drive reporting and analytics, and manage documentation.
  • Engage third parties and act as Technical Point of Contact for licensed systems.
  • Continuously improve product lifecycle using feedback and metrics.

Qualifications:

  • Expertise in Global Trade Compliance practices and technology.
  • Experience in product development, backlog management, and Agile delivery.
  • Strong understanding of business processes, customer experience, and SDLC.
  • Excellent communication, problem-solving, and leadership skills.
  • Foundational knowledge in Data Engineering and Interface Mapping.

These will help you stand out: Knowledge of JIRA, Roadmunk, and training in Data Engineering, Cybersecurity, or Emerging Tech.

Travel: Up to 10% domestic/international Salary: $110,000–$130,000 + annual incentive Benefits: Medical/Dental/Vision, PTO, 401(k), parental leave, stock purchase plan Application Deadline: 01/07/2026 Visa sponsorship not available.
